Tips to remember the Russian word "ли":
– Think of "ли" as a simple, small connector similar to "whether" in English, used in questions or conditional statements.
– Imagine the sound "li" as in "little," to recall the brevity and simplicity of the word "ли."

Explanations:
– "Ли" is an interrogative particle used in Russian to indicate a question where the answer is not known or to present alternatives. It often serves a similar function to the word "whether" or "if" in English.
– It usually follows the verb directly and is commonly seen in indirect questions or uncertainty expressions.

Other words that mean the same thing:
– "Еcли" (yesli) – This means "if" in conditional sentences, but it can sometimes be used similarly in indirect question structures when "ли" is implied.

Alternate meanings like slang:
– "Ли" itself doesn't have slang meanings as it is a grammatical particle. Its usage is fairly standard and formal.

Examples of sentences that use it:
1. Не знаю, пойдёт ли он на вечеринку. (Ne znayu, poydyot li on na vecherinku.)
– I don't know whether he will go to the party.

2. Ты знаешь, придёт ли она завтра? (Ty znayesh, pridyot li ona zavtra?)
– Do you know if she will come tomorrow?

3. Важно решить, будем ли мы участвовать. (Vazhno re', budem li my uchastvovat'.)
– It’s important to decide whether we will participate.

4. Интересно, будет ли дождь. (Interesno, budet li dozhd'.)
– I wonder whether it will rain.
